Proudly Protecting Oklahoma: The 75th Anniversary of the Oklahoma Highway Patrol candle Red Dirt Baseball: The Post-WarThe need for a state police force in Oklahoma became evident in the 1930s as the popularity of the automobile and the lack of paved roads caused a spike in traffic injuries and fatalities. In addition to traffic control, a statewide police force was necessary to nab criminals who used high speed get a way cars to travel across county lines where the local sheriff had to halt his pursuit.
